First, you need to download free music for video editing.

Then you can add the music track to your video using a video editing software like iMovie, Sony Vegas, Movie Maker and such. Once you open the video editor, you can drag and drop your music onto the dashboard. Then you can edit the volume, speed and duration. After completing the editing process of your video, you can share it on major platforms like YouTube, Vimeo and Instagram. If you want to add music to your Twitch stream, you need to go to the Editor tab on Twitch dashboard.

There you will see Sources box. Click the Add button, choose Media Source and select the royalty free music you want to add to your stream. That is all! If you ever tried uploading a video to YouTube, you will find out that YouTube offers a large audio library with creative commons music and sound effects.

You don't necessarily need to publish a video in order to use YouTube Audio Library. In fact, you can directly download songs or sound effects and use free video editing software to add the music to your footage.

If you see the attribution-required icon, make sure to credit the artist in the description or in your video.

In most cases, when we talk about free music, the work either falls into the category of public domain music, or music protected by free licenses. In plain language, music enters into the public domain when no one owns copyright to it. There are several cases when it happens:. Please note, people automatically own the copyright for the work they created, be it a piece of music, a painting, a photo, or any other creative work.

Most of the public domain musical works offered online are compositions and scores. To illustrate, even if a musical work has entered into the public domain, it doesn't mean that the sound recordings of that artwork are in the public domain.

People performing the artwork still retain rights to the sound recordings of that performance. According to the organization itself, " Creative Commons is a system that allows you to legally use some rights reserved music, movies, images, and other content — all for free.
